Fabrizio Romano has revealed why the Liverpool deal for Florian Wirtz will take some time despite his Here We Go on the player earlier this week.
Liverpool have reached a full agreement with Bayer Leverkusen to sign German international Florian Wirtz, in a move that will smash both the club’s and the Premier League’s transfer records.
According to German outlet Kicker, which has been highly reliable throughout the summer, the deal is now done between the two clubs, with only a medical and the formalities of contract signing remaining.
The total package for Wirtz is said to be worth around €150 million (£127–£128 million), including both guaranteed and performance-related bonuses.
This figure will make Wirtz the most expensive signing in Liverpool’s history, as well as the most expensive player ever to move to the Premier League.
The previous record for a British club was held by Chelsea, who paid up to £115 million for Moises Caicedo in 2023.
Leverkusen’s management had been steadfast in their valuation, insisting Wirtz would only leave for a fee close to €150 million.
And while the deal in theory is complete, there is still on thing holding up the deal.
Taking to Instagram, Fabrizio Romano first confirmed that the deal was done:
“Florian Wirtz will be a new Liverpool player, the ‘Here We Go’ was on Tuesday and I can confirm the information; the agreement between Liverpool and Bayer Leverkusen, everything is done and just waiting for the formal steps,” the transfer journalist confirmed.
“Sending all the contracts, signing all the documents, and from Florian Wirtz to complete his medical test.”
The Italian then revealed that Wirtz is currently on holiday, and thus his medical can only be conducted when he returns in the “next days”:
“Why is it not done yet?
Because Wirtz is on holiday now after the games with the German national team,” Romano explained
“As soon as he returns from holidays in the next days, he will complete his medical at Liverpool and sign his contract as a new club record deal.”
“Florian Wirtz to Liverpool was, is, and remains a ‘Here We Go'”.
